IMPORTANT: End of day time changes for Nursery & Reception:

We are pleased to confirm that from the start of this term, the Nursery and Reception class days will be extended. This means that Nursery class will finish at 3:00pm Monday – Thursday (2:00pm Friday) and Reception class will finish at 3:15pm Monday – Thursday (2:15pm Friday). All other classes will continue to finish at 3:15pm Monday-Thursday and 2:15pm on Friday. Please note, the staggered start dates for Early Years children still apply this week.

A reminder that children should wear school uniform every day. School uniform is a blue jumper/cardigan or hoodie, white polo shirt or button-up shirt/blouse, school trousers or skirt, school shoes or dark, plain trainers. PE kit is a plain white t-shirt and blue/black shorts/joggers and trainers or plimsolls.

We have a large stock of nearly new uniform in school available in a range of sizes that is always available on request. Please give us a call or drop us an email if you need any additional uniform.
